The Power of Positive Aging

February 26, 2026 by Admin Leave a Comment

Facebooktwitterpinterestmailby feather

The idea of aging can be scary. The unknown can be intimidating. That’s why it’s so important to hear from those who come before us. Video interviews have become the online version of sitting at our elder’s feet and listening closely as they share their

wisdom, meaning that wisdom can have a reach most of us never would have imagined.

That was the case with 98-year-old Sybil Sparks, who sat down with Dash Media as part of the interviews we do and share on social media. Her very first video, where she talked about her faith, her daughters (who are now “old ladies” in their 70s), her husband and her work as a nurse, struck a chord with thousands people — friends and strangers alike.

Sybil’s message has been viewed more than 400,000 times across LSM’s social media platforms, eliciting hundreds of comments and making the nicest comment sections on social media!

She even received a Christmas card from someone in Indiana who had been moved by her story.

Seeing Sybil’s example of aging well meant a lot to many people of all ages. Some young people shared that they hoped they would be like Sybil in their 90s. Some shared that they missed their parents, wishing they still had them around and noting how lucky Sybil’s daughters are. And others, Sybil’s peers, shared the same sentiment she did: they are loving their golden years and enjoying their current stage of life.

Clearly, a life well lived is an inspiration to all. And this is a good reminder to talk to the seniors in your life and ask them questions about all kinds of topics from love to family to their favorite books/movies or childhood memories. You never know what you may learn!

Celebrating 70 years of ministry and service to the seniors of Clifton and Bosque County, Lutheran Sunset Ministries offers inspired retirement living options at every life stage. Our 32-acre campus is designed as an intimate setting of neighborhoods that accommodate residents at various levels of care. In addition to quality health and wellness opportunities, Lutheran Sunset Ministries provides an enriched lifestyle through innovative programs, interdisciplinary activities, and a focus on physical, intellectual, social and spiritual growth.

Providing the only full continuum of care available in Bosque County—including independent living, assisted living, long-term care, rehabilitation and therapy, memory support, hospice services and companion services—Lutheran Sunset Ministries is a cornerstone of the region. With a state-of-the-art healthcare building, an increase in services and amenities, and a rededication to providing services that allow people to live full and enriched lives, Lutheran Sunset Ministries has created a quality of life unparalleled in the region.
